LS 600h L Hybrid Technology (continued)
Inverter – Converts the hybrid battery’s high voltage DC current into
AC current for the electric motors and vice versa, depending on driving
demands and electrical system needs. The inverter can also boost the
hybrid battery’s power up to 650 volts as needed.
Hybrid Electronic ControlSystem - Monitors and controls the power
flow operation of MG1, MG2 and the inverter.
RegenerativeBraking System – Helps recover energy used to slow the
vehicle during braking or coasting. During braking or coasting, MG2
turns into a generator, which creates electricity to help charge the hybrid
battery. As MG2 creates electricity, it creates drag, which helps slow the
vehicle. The conventional brake system and the regenerative brake system
work in conjunction with each other.
Electronically-controlled Continuously Variable Transmission (ECVT) –
Delivers smooth acceleration without conventional gear shifting, while
enhancing efficiency. It has fewer parts than a conventional automatic
transmission. MG1 and MG2 are part of the ECVT. The advanced
combination of the electric motor/generators and low and high range
torque multiplication device helps optimize available performance
and economy.
12-volt Battery – Enables the Hybrid Electronic Control System to "start"
the vehicle (vehicle “READY” mode) and operates the basic
electrical system. This battery is charged by the DC/DC converter.
